    Keep Your French Braids Looking Fresh Longer

    A silk scarf or satin bonnet at night can make a huge difference when it comes to keeping French braids neat. It helps protect laid edges and cuts down on frizz while you sleep.

    If your scalp starts feeling dry, use a light scalp oil instead of heavy grease. Too much product can make braided styles look dull and feel sticky much faster.

    Related Hairstyles To Consider

    Fulani Braids

    Fulani braids have a similar sleek and protective feel but usually include beads, curved parts, or loose braided pieces. I love them when I want something detailed that still feels elegant and wearable every day.

    Stitch Braids

    Stitch braids give that super clean and polished finish that French braid lovers usually enjoy. The sharp parting and neat braid lines make the whole hairstyle look fresh and modern.

    Goddess Braids

    Goddess braids are thicker and softer looking which makes them perfect if you like bold braid styles with a feminine touch. They also work beautifully for special events and photos.

    Knotless Box Braids

    Knotless box braids are great for anyone who loves long protective styles but wants more flexibility with styling. They feel lightweight and can easily be worn in buns, ponytails, or half up looks.

    Common French Braid Mistakes To Avoid

    One mistake I see all the time is braiding the hair too tightly at the roots. Super tight braids might look sleek at first, but they can leave your scalp sore and uncomfortable after a few days.

    Heavy edge control can also make braided styles look greasy faster than expected. A small amount usually works best and still keeps everything smooth and neat.
